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04 105 6316921290
88824 641 617
88824 641 617
5492999829 0309 76 01336882455 6475097
All about undefined
Interested in learning more?
88824 641 617
5492999829 0309 76 01336882455 6475097
See more
79 79
44636177 25783867439 63159
See more
476 82421943020
65071 29159 15 778
See more